Compared to the prior art the utility model, has advantages below and effect:Disc-like workpiece is clamped by triangle chuck
And rotate, the piston rod of cylinder stretches out, and drives push rod to slide to the left and realize to disc-like workpiece pre-tightening by rocking bar and connecting rod.
Motor passes through the first belt pulley, driving belt and the second belt pulley and drives screw mandrel smooth rotation, and screw mandrel drives translation bearing
Slide to the left, the cutter on toolframe realizes the turnery processing to disc-like workpiece with translation bearing to left movement.Due to push rod
When holding out against disc-like workpiece, rocking bar is in alignment with connecting rod, and self-locking dead-centre position and in mechanism.Now, even if cylinder unloads
Pressure, push rod still can keep disc-like workpiece is held out against, good stability.It is provided with slip between push rod and push rod bearing to lead
Set, is conducive to push rod smoothly to horizontally slip, and reduces the abrasion between push rod and push rod bearing, improves the use longevity of push rod
Life.Motor is stepper motor, and the rotating speed of stepper motor, the position stopping are solely dependent upon frequency and the pulse of pulse signal
Number, and do not affected by loading to change, good reliability.The utility model is realized the push rod in processing and all the time disc-like workpiece is entered
Row holds out against, and is conducive to the turnery processing of disc-like workpiece, rational in infrastructure, good reliability.
